Title :
The gassing of liquid dielectrics under electrical stress — Part I

Abstract :
The results of a study of the breakdown of a U.S.P. white mineral oil under electrical stress are presented. The extent of the breakdown was studied by measuring the pressure of gas developed during the application of voltage, starting with a system that was initially evacuated. The apparatus was constructed so that thorough degassing of the oil could be achieved prior to subjecting it to voltage stress. The oil was subjected to an alternating voltage (60 c.p.s.) under a stress of 130 kv/cm.
